Meet the new Co-Executive Director Guff Van Vooren!
Get the Goods on Guff
Hi STLF Family,
I’m so jazzed to serve your organization and mission work with all of you! As a future STLFer, I’d like to thank all of you for creating and growing such an amazing organization. From the co-founders; to past and present board members, staff, and student volunteers; to donors and community partners; the magic you’ve created together inspires me as I embark on my next dream adventure as Co-Executive Director of STLF!
I am passionate about providing volunteers, including youth, with opportunities to make a difference in the world and to unleash their leadership potential. As a life-long learner, I seek adventure everyday and I delight in team-oriented initiatives and relationship building. I hope my diverse work experience in fields ranging from public accounting, to hospitality guest services, to my non-profit efforts involving volunteerism and youth outdoor education will benefit STLF as it aims to reach its 5-year goal to double in size in 2016. I’m energized to be part of the next stage leadership that helps STLF grow mindfully, sustainably, and strong, both internally and externally. My passion for serving this organization and its constituents (including you!) will guide all decisions I make with the STLF team.
I’d like to send big kudos to Brian Peterson, my predecessor, as I transition into his role. As a co-founder and leader of this organization Brian has made an indelible mark on the volunteers, partners, and communities that STLF serves. I’ve got big shoes to fill and look forward to this wonderful opportunity. I wish Brian the best of luck as he transitions into his next life adventure. I will look to him his fellow co-founders, and all of you for guidance and inspiration in my new role.
